INEC completes BVAS reconfiguration, deploys to states for Saturday polls

INEC BVAS INEC BVAS

The Independent National Electoral Commission (INEC) has announced the completition of the re-configuration of the Bimodal Voter Accreditation System (BVAS) machines.

The BVAS machines which was used for the February 25 presidential and National Assembly elections, is set to be used for the gubernatorial election on March 18.

Recall that INEC delayed the governorship and state assembly election in other to allow for the re-configuration of the BVAS machines after a court ruling.

According to an official of the commission, the machines would be deployed to INEC state offices before sending them to local governments, wards and polling units (PUs) on election day.

INEC had earlier revealed that over 170,000 polling unit results from the presidential and National Assembly elections on February 25 had been uploaded to its Result Viewing Portal (IReV).

The electoral commission had mention that no political party would be permitted to examine the BVAS machine or voter biometrics.

According to reports, the Nigerian Air Force (NAF) is said to lead the airlift of the BVAS machines for the security and smoothness of the operation.

“The early deployment from Wednesday to the states was to ensure that there are no lapses or delays in their deployment. They would be moved to safe locations in states and to the LGAs, wards and polling units,” the official said.
